1. Ensuring Accurate Product Listings

One of the biggest challenges brands face is inconsistencies in product listings across different menus. Whether it’s a restaurant, an online marketplace, or a third-party delivery app, incorrect product descriptions can mislead customers and damage brand credibility. Using tools like Lit Alerts allows marketers to:

  • Monitor live menu listings in real time.

  • Easily see when discrepancies in product descriptions or pricing arise.

  • Ensure that key selling points and brand messaging are consistently represented.

By leveraging these insights, marketing teams can work quickly to correct any errors and maintain a unified brand presence.

2. Verifying Product Images for Brand Consistency

A picture is worth a thousand words, and for brands, product images can significantly influence customer decisions. However, inconsistencies in images across different menus can create confusion and weaken brand identity. Insight tools help marketing professionals:

  • Identify any outdated or incorrect product images.

  • Ensure high-quality images are being used across all platforms.

  • Align visuals with current brand guidelines to maintain a cohesive look.

By proactively addressing image inconsistencies, brands can enhance their visual appeal and create a more engaging customer experience.

3. Monitoring Brand Compliance Across Multiple Platforms

With an increasing number of digital and physical sales channels, brand compliance is more important than ever. Marketing professionals can use data tools to:

  • Track how their products appear across different regions and platforms.

  • Identify unauthorized modifications to brand messaging.

  • Standardize brand communication across all digital menus and retailer listings.

Ensuring brand compliance helps maintain trust with consumers and reinforces a brand’s reputation in the market.

4. Optimizing Product Positioning and Visibility

Beyond maintaining consistency, insight tools can also provide valuable data on how products are being positioned within a menu or store layout. Marketers can:

  • Analyze whether their products are featured prominently.

  • Determine if competitors are gaining more visibility.

  • Use data-driven insights to suggest better positioning and promotional strategies.

By using these insights, marketing teams can collaborate with partners to improve product placement and maximize sales opportunities.
